iStock is one of the major stock photography outlets I regularly supply material to. They pioneered "microstock" and have continued to innovate the way stock imagery is produced and consumed. They're part of the Getty Images family, more recently, a big part.

The Frederick Camera Clique is a Frederick based photography club and their juried art exhibition that runs every summer at the Mary Condon Hodgeson Gallery at Frederick Community College is considered to be one of the most prestigious shows in the area. It draws artists from all over Maryland, DC, Virginia, and Pennsylvania resulting in a great show and stiff competition for all who enter.This summer was their 23rd annual show.
